Notification Recipients in the Business Central Admin Center

Microsoft allows tenant administrators to sign up for automated email notifications about environment lifecycle events through the Notification Recipients list in the Business Central admin center. Because Boltrics manages your updates on your behalf, these notifications can overlap with or contradict the planning shown in your Boltrics environment. This article explains what these notifications are, what Boltrics recommends, and what to do with the emails you may receive.

What are Notification Recipients?

Notification Recipients is a list of email addresses in the Business Central admin center. Everyone on this list receives automated emails directly from Microsoft about administrative events that occur on your tenant.

Examples of notifications Microsoft sends to recipients on this list include:

  • Update Available – a new major or minor version is available for your environment.
  • Update Scheduled / Postponed / Resumed – the planned update date for your environment has changed.
  • Update Succeeded or Failed – the outcome of a completed update run.
  • Extension Compatibility Issues – an installed app or extension is not compatible with the upcoming version. These emails typically have a subject like "Modify your extension so it's compatible with version XX.X.XXXXX.X".
  • Blocked Updates – the update has been paused because an extension blocks it. Microsoft resends these notifications periodically until the issue is resolved.

Boltrics recommendation: do not subscribe

We recommend that you do not add yourself to the Notification Recipients list. Boltrics manages the entire update lifecycle on your behalf, for both Microsoft updates and Boltrics updates. To do this, we maintain our own update environment inside Business Central (the Boltrics Customers list), which is the single source of truth for your planning. This environment shows:

  • The scheduled Microsoft major and minor updates.
  • The scheduled Boltrics updates.
  • The release notes and version information for each upcoming update.
  • The option to reschedule your update within the allowed 2–8 week window.

Because Boltrics plans and communicates both the Microsoft and the Boltrics side of your update, the Microsoft notification emails are redundant at best and confusing at worst. Customers who subscribe can receive emails that conflict with the schedule Boltrics has planned for them.

Note

Boltrics may change the Microsoft update date in the admin center to align it with your Boltrics planning. As a result, the update date shown in your Boltrics environment is leading and reflects the planning that will actually be executed.

How to remove yourself from Notification Recipients

  1. Sign in to the Business Central admin center at https://businesscentral.dynamics.com/<yourtenantID>/admin, replacing <yourtenantID> with your own Microsoft Entra tenant ID.
  2. In the left-hand menu, select "Notification Recipients".
  3. Select the row with the email address you want to remove.
  4. Click "Remove recipient" at the top of the page.
  5. Confirm the removal.

Repeat the steps for every recipient you want to remove.

How to add yourself to Notification Recipients

If you still want to receive Microsoft notifications directly, follow these steps:

  1. Sign in to the Business Central admin center at https://businesscentral.dynamics.com/<yourtenantID>/admin, replacing <yourtenantID> with your own Microsoft Entra tenant ID.
  2. In the left-hand menu, select "Notification Recipients".
  3. Click "Add recipient" at the top of the page.
  4. Enter the "Name" and "Email Address" of the recipient.
  5. Click Save.

You can add up to 100 recipients. For larger groups, use a distribution list.

If you choose to stay subscribed

If you prefer to remain a Notification Recipient, please keep the following in mind: Modify your extension" emails can be ignored. You may receive emails with the subject "Modify your extension so it's compatible with version XX.X.XXXXX.X". These emails can refer to Boltrics-published extensions. Boltrics manages these extensions and ensures they are compatible and up to date before your production update takes place. We monitor this for all customers as part of every update cycle, so no action is required on your part and you can safely ignore these emails.

The Microsoft update date in admin center may change

You may notice that the update date shown in the Microsoft admin center differs from the date shown in "Boltrics Customers", or that Boltrics changes the Microsoft update date in the admin center. This is expected behaviour:

  • The Boltrics customer list is the leading source for your update planning.
  • Boltrics aligns the Microsoft update date in the admin center with the schedule in "Boltrics Customers" to keep both systems consistent.
  • If you reschedule your update through "Boltrics Customers", the corresponding date in the Microsoft admin center will also be updated by Boltrics.

Do not reschedule Microsoft updates directly in the admin center. Always use "Boltrics Customers" – see How can I change my update date? for instructions.

FAQ

Question Answer
I received an email about an incompatible extension. Do I need to do anything? No. Boltrics manages extension compatibility as part of every update cycle. You can ignore these emails.
Why does the update date in the admin center differ from Boltrics Customers? The Boltrics customer list is leading. Boltrics aligns the admin center date with the Boltrics schedule so that both reflect the same planning.
Should I reschedule my update through the admin center? No. Always reschedule through "Boltrics Customers". See How can I change my update date?.
